Red Arrows
»
The official website of the Royal Air Force Aerobatic Team, The Red Arrows. Acknowledged as one of the world’s premier aerobatic teams, The Red Arrows are the public face of the Royal Air Force. The Red Arrows exist to demonstrate the professional excellence of the RAF and promote recruitment to the RAF. Evidence shows that The Red Arrows have inspired a significant number of people to join the RAF, both as officers and airmen, and to all trades, not just aircrew. Includes news, information and schedules of The Red Arrows.

SnowBirds
»
The Snowbirds Demonstration Team (431 Squadron) is a Canadian icon comprised of serving members of the Canadian Forces and Reserves. Their pilots and technicians work as a team to bring thrilling performances to the North American public. Serving as Canadian ambassadors, the Snowbirds demonstrate the high level of professionalism, teamwork, excellence, discipline and dedication inherent in the women and men of the Air Force and the Canadian Forces. Provides air show schedules, history, frequently asked questions, photos and videos.

Thunderbirds
»
The Official website of the United States Air Force Thunderbirds. Since their inaugural flight in 1953, the aircraft have evolved. Crewmembers have come and gone. But the Thunderbirds' focus remains the same: precise flying with an emphasis on excellence. From the first red, white and blue F-84G to the awesome power and unmatched performance of today's F-16C, the Thunderbirds continue to showcase America's frontline fighters and demonstrate the skill of every U.S. Air Force fighter pilot. Provides schedule, video clips, aircraft information, image library, general information and history of the Thunderbirds.
